Technical Analysis
AMC Entertainment Holdings, Inc. experienced a troublesome trading day on November 10, 2023, with the stock closing at $8.01 after a $0.70 (8.04%) loss due to the impact of recent news. From a technical standpoint, AMC is showing significant bearish signals. The stock is trading well below the 50-day moving average of $9.18 and even further below the 200-day moving average of $38.56, indicating a strong downtrend and perhaps negative sentiment in the mid-to-long term.
Further emphasizing the bearish outlook, the RSI (Relative Strength Index) is at 41, which suggests that AMC is neither oversold nor overbought, providing little to no momentum that indicates a change in the current downward trend. The ATR (Average True Range) suggests high volatility with a value of approximately $11.98, which may indicate larger than normal price moves in the upcoming trading sessions.
With the reported support level at $7.57 and resistance at $8.14, which is just above the last close price, there may be room for a slight recovery, but these levels would need to be breached convincingly for any major trend reversal to be considered credible.
Fundamental Analysis
On the fundamental side, AMC Entertainment's performance presents a mixed picture. The positive news comes from the fact that AMC beat Q3 revenue estimates with over $1.4 billion. However, investors have been significantly diluted by the company's recent equity offerings, which led to a dramatic 15% drop in share price. The continued negative working capital indicates that AMC may need to pursue even more equity sales in the future.
A negative earnings per share (EPS) of $-5.74 along with a negative P/E ratio of -1.4 reflect the company's lack of profitability. Despite the disc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is suggesting a value of $12.83, which is higher than the last close price, the fundamentals indicate financial distress.
Analysts' ratings, as per consensus, suggest a 'Hold' status with 3 holds, 3 sells, and only 2 buys (1 each strong buy and buy). The target consensus price is $19, which shows a glimmer of optimistic valuation, but such a target may be speculative given the recent financial turbulence AMC is facing.
Market Sentiment and News Impact
The recent news indicates a lack of shareholder confidence in management, with a substantial number wanting to replace the entertainment company's board. This is compounded by equities selling to raise needed cash, which has not been well-received by the market, as evidenced by the plunge in share price. This action signifies high financial risk for existing and potential shareholders.
Furthermore, the broader market sentiment toward stocks like AMC appears cautious, with some investors looking to offload risky assets in anticipation of a potential market crash.
